Upload
others
View
1
Download
0
Embed Size (px)
Citation preview
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
ACADEMIC YEAR: 2020-21 SEM : II
LIST OF COURSES
S.no Year Course Name Course Code
1
II
Discrete Mathematics(C221) CS401PC
2 Business Economics & Financial Analysis (C222) SM402MS
3 Operating Systems (C223) CS403PC
4 Database Management Systems (C224) CS404PC
5 Java Programming (C225) CS405PC
7
III
Machine Learning(C322) CS601PC
8 Compiler Design (C322) CS602PC
9 Design And Analysis Of Algorithm(C323) CS603PC
10 Software Testing Methodologies (C324) CS615PE
11 Internet Of Things (C325) EC600OE
13
IV
Management Information Systems (C421) EE832OE
14 Modern Software Engineering(C422) CS854PE
15 Computer Forensics(C423) CS863PE
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: II Sem: II
Course Name: DISCRETE MATHEMATICS (C221)
Course Code: CS304P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C221.1 Understand and construct precise mathematical proofs. Understand
C221.2 Illustrate and use logic and set theory to formulate precise statements.
Apply
C221.3 Analyze and solve counting problems on finite and discrete structures
Analyse
C221.4 Use advanced Counting Techniques to formulate counting problems and solve.
Understand
C221.5 Describe and manipulate sequences. Analyse
C221.6 Apply graph theory in solving computing problems Apply
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C221.1 1 2
2 3
C221.2 2 1 2
2 2
C221.3 2 1 2 3
2 3
C221.4 2 1 1 1 2 3
C221.5 2 1 1 3
2
C221.6
3
3
C221 1.5 1.5 1.5 2
3 2 2.5
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: II Sem: II
Course Name: BUSINESS ECONOMICS & FINANCIAL ANALYSIS (C222)
Course Code: SM402MS
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C222.1 Identifies the various form of business Remember
C222.2 Understands the impact of economic variables on the business Understand
C222.3 Analyses the demand and supply analysis Analyze
C222.4 Applies production, cost, Market structure Apply
C222.5 Evaluates the firms financial position Evaluate
C222.6 summarizes with the Financial statements of a company Create
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C222.1 1 2
3
2 3
C222.2 1
3
2
3 1
C222.3 1 2
3
2
C222.4 1 2 3 1 3
C222.5
1
2
3
3
C222.6
3
2
1
2 1
C222 1 2.33 2 2 2.33 2.5 2 0 3 0 2.2 2
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: II Sem: II
Course Name: OPERATING SYSTEMS (C223)
Course Code: CS403P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C223.1 Explain and compare the different types of OS and basic architectural components involved in OS design
Understand
C223.2 Solve problems related to the process management, memory management and secondary storage management
Apply
C223.3 Analyze process of synchronization and deadlocks. Analyse
C223.4 Identify which technique can be applied to File system management done by Operating Systems.
Apply
C223.5 Apply the concepts of OS, for the Page Replacement algorithms. Apply
C223.6 Understand the concepts of File system structure. Understand
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C223.1 3 2
2
C223.2
3 2
3
C223.3
3 3
2
C223.4 2 2 2
C223.5 3 2 2
2
C223.6
3
2
2 1
C223 2.66 2.5 2 2.5
2 2
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: II Sem: II
Course Name: DATABASE MANAGEMENT SYSTEMS (C224)
Course Code: CS404P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C224.1 Gain knowledge of fundamentals of DBMS and database design. Understand
C224.2 Attains theoretical foundation for relational databases and SQL using Relational Algebra and relational model depending on various constraints
Analyze
C224.3 Master the basics of SQL for retrieval and management of data. Understand
C224.4 Apply normalization techniques for the development of application software without redundancy.
Apply
C224.5 Be acquainted with the basics of transaction processing and concurrency control.
Understand
C224.6 Familiarity with database storage structures and access techniques Understand
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C224.1 3 2 1
3
C224.2 3 2 1
3
C224.3
2 2 3
2 3
C224.4 2 3 1 1 3
C224.5 3 2
3
C224.6 3 2
3
C224 3 2 1.7 1 2 1 3
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: II Sem: II
Course Name: JAVA PROGRAMMING (C225)
Course Code: CS405P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C225.1 Solve real world problems using OOP techniques. Apply C225.2 Describes the use of abstract classes. Understand C225.3 Solves problems using java collection framework and I/o classes. Apply C225.4 Develops multithreaded applications with synchronization. Apply
C225.5 Designs web applications using Applets Create
C225.6 Designs GUI based applications Create
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C225.1 1 3 2 1 1
C225.2 2 3 1
C225.3 2 3 1
C225.4 2 3 1 1 C225.5 1 2 3 1 1
C225.6 2 3 2 1 1
C225 1.5 2 2.66 2 2 1 1
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: III Sem: II
Course Name: MACHINE LEARNING(C322)
Course Code: CS601P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C321.1 Understand the concepts of computational intelligence, Perspective and issues of Machine Learning.
Understand
C321.2 Describe the concepts of decision tree learning and analysis of its functionalities.
Understand
C321.3 Understand and apply the Neural Networks and its usage in Machine Learning and its applications
Apply
C321.4 Explain the various conditional probabilistic Learning and Instance -based Learnings and its applications.
Understand
C321.5 Understand the genetic algorithms, genetic programming and Learning Sets Rules and Reinforcement Learning and analysis those functionalities.
Analyze
C321.6 Explains the analytical Learning with perfect domain theories, augment search operators and inductive Learning abilities.
Understand
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C321.1 1 3 1 2 C321.2 1 2 3 1 2 C321.3 1 3 2 1 2 C321.4 1 2 3 1 2 C321.5 1 2 3 2 1 2 C321.6 1 2 3 1 2 C321 1 2.2 2.8 2 1 2
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: III Sem: II
Course Name: COMPILER DESIGN (C322)
Course Code: CS602P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C322.1 Demonstrate the ability to design a compiler given a set of language features. Apply
C322.2 Demonstrate the knowledge of patterns, tokens & regular expressions for lexical analysis Apply
C322.3 Acquire skills in using lex tool &yacc tool for developing a scanner and parser Apply
C322.4 Design and implement LL and LR parsers Create C322.5 Design algorithms to do code optimization in order to improve the
performance of a program in terms of space and time complexity. Create C322.6 Design algorithms to generate machine code. Create
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C322.1 3
2
3 3
C322.2
3
3
2 3
C322.3
3
2 1
2 2
C322.4 3 1 2 2 2
C322.5 3
1 3
2 3
C322.6
2
3
1 2
C322 3 2.66 1 2.4
2 2.5
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: III Sem: II
Course Name: DESIGN AND ANALYSIS OF ALGORITHM(C323)
Course Code: CS603PC
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C323.1 Analyze algorithms and estimate their best-case, worst-case and average-case behavior.
Analyse
C323.2 Develop algorithms using standard paradigms like: Greedy, Divide and Conquer, Dynamic Programming and Backtracking.
Create
C323.3 Solves the problems on Knapsack problem, Job sequencing with deadlines, Minimum cost spanning trees, Single source shortest path problem
Apply
C323.4 Construct algorithms using advance data structures and implement traversals techniques.
Create
C323.5 Choose NP class problems and formulate solutions using standard approaches.
Analyse
C323.6 Explain good principles of algorithm design and apply the same to real Understand
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2
C323.1 1 3 3
C323.2 3 2
C323.3 2 3 2
C323.4 1 2 2 3
C323.5 1 2
C323.6 2 3 3
C323 1 2.3 2.75 1 2.6
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: III Sem: II
Course Name: SOFTWARE TESTING METHODOLOGIES (C324)
Course Code: CS615PE
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C324.1 Understand purpose of testing in the developed software for its functionality and performance.
Understand
C324.2 Analyse the best test strategies in accordance to the development model like transaction flow testing, Dataflow testing and domain testing.
Analyse
C324.3 Uses various methodologies in testing for developed software Apply
C324.4 Develop the best test strategies such as logic-based testing, transition testing in accordance to the development model.
Apply
C324.5 Design the state graphs, graph metrices to identify the flow of testing. Analyse
C324.6 Apply various testing techniques along with its tools Apply
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C324.1 2 1 3 2
C324.2 2 2 2 2 2
C324.3 2 2 2 2
C324.4 1 2 3 2
C324.5 2 2 3 2 2
C324.6 2 2 2 2 3 2
C324 2 1.6 2.2 2.3 3 2
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: III Sem: II
Course Name: INTERNET OF THINGS (C325)
Course Code: EC600OE
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C325.1 Understand the architecture of Internet of Things and connected world Understand
C325.2 Explore the use of various hardware and sensing technologies to build IoT applications
Apply
C325.3 Understand the available cloud services and communication AP’s for developing smart Applications
Apply
C325.4 Implementation of SDN for IoT Apply
C325.5 Interfacing Python programing with Raspberry Pi Apply
C325.6 Illustrate the Real time applications of IoT with Case studies design Analyze
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2
C325.1 3 2 3
C325.2 1 2 3 1 3
C325.3 1 2 3 1 3
C325.4 1 2 3 1 3
C325.5 1 2 3 1 3
C325.6 2 3 1 1 3
C325 1.5 2.2 2.6 1.16 3
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: IV Sem: II
Course Name: MANAGEMENT INFORMATION SYSTEMS (C421)
Course Code: EE832OE
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C421.1 Understand the usage of MIS in organization and the constituents of the MIS.
Understand
C421.2 Understand the classifications of MIS, Understanding of functional MIS and the different functionalities of these MIS.
Analyze
C421.3 Assess the requirement and the stage in which the Organization is placed .
Analyse
C421.4 Learn the functions and issues at each stage of system development. Understand
C421.5 Interpret how to use information technology to solve business problems. Analyse
C421.6 The ability to use knowledge and skills related to digital technologies to enhance business administration and decision making.
Apply
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2 C421.1 3
3 3
C421.2 3 2 1
2 3
C421.3 3
2 2
C421.4 2 1
2 2
C421.5 3 2
2 3
C421.6 3 2
1 2
C421 3 2.25 3 1.33
2 2.5
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: IV Sem: II
Course Name: MODERN SOFTWARE ENGINEERING(C422)
Course Code: CS854PE
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C422.1 Gains knowledge on the concepts of XP and its life cycle. Understand
C422.2 Analyze Real customer involvement and coding standards Analyze
C422.3 Compares the various releasing concepts of MSE. Analyse
C422.4 Understands the various planning methods of Modern Engineering Understand
C422.5 Analyzes different testing concepts, designs architecture and improves Performance optimization
Analyse
C422.6 Applies the concepts of Agile software Development Apply
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2
C422.1 3 2 1 2
C422.2 1 3 2 1 2
C422.3 1 2 3 1 1 1 2
C422.4 3 1 1 2 1 1
2
C422.5 3 2 1 2 1 1 1
2
C422.6 2 3 2 1 1 2
C422 2.1 2 1.8 2 2 1 1 2
DEPARTMENT OF COMPUTER SCIENCE AND ENGINERING
Academic Year: 2020-21 Year: IV Sem: II
Course Name: COMPUTER FORENSICS(C423)
Course Code: CS863PE
COURSE OUTCOMES:
Course Outcome
Course Outcome Statement Bloom’s Taxonomy level
C423.1 Understands the usage of computers in forensics. Understand
C423.2 Analyses the usage of various forensic tools. Analyze
C423.3 Conduct investigations using tools. Apply
C423.4 Explore the working on Windows, DOS systems towards computer Forensics.
Understand
C423.5 Understand acquisition procedures for cell phones and mobile devices in perspective of Computer Forensics.
Apply
C423.6 Creates Zeal towards research in Computer Forensics Apply
Mapping of CO’s with POs & PSOs
PO/CO PO1 PO2 PO3 PO4 PO5 PO6 PO7 PO8 PO9 PO10 PO11 PO12 PSO1 PSO2
C423.1 3 1 2
C423.2 2 3 1 2
C423.3 2 3 1 2
C423.4 3 2 2
C423.5 3 2 2
C423.6 1 3 2 3
C423 2.3 2.3 2 1 2.1